Got in the wife's car today and pushed the button to crank, took a while to crank and the smell of gas was very strong after cranking. We arrived at destination and the gas smell is very strong. Any ideas?2015 tahoe

2015 Tahoe is direct injected. If it took a while to crank sounds like you got a high press metal fuel line to injector leaking.

Powertrain won't cover it if it's the fuel feed line to injectors or injector o-rings. If it is a fuel evap issue the 8 year 80K emissions warranty should cover it.
I would get someone to eyeball it and see if you have a fuel leak on top of the engine. If not pull codes and see if you have a P0455 or similar fuel evap large leak etc code.

I've seen #8 injector with cut o-rings on 2 Silverado's with direct injection. I've had my ass kicked by a P0455 code on a older Tahoe. That Tahoe came in with hard start/long start after getting fuel. Smoked evap system never found a leak. Replaced purged valve, no help. Long story short it ended up being a clogged vent on the fuel tank.
